There's no doubt Seattle loves their Sounders. Yesterday afternoon -- a work/school day! -- tens of thousands crammed downtown for a victory parade and rally ending near the iconic Space Needle. The Sounders, as we all know, are a colorful bunch who like to go big. So it's really best to try to take in the top visuals from the massive moving party.


First off, goalkeeper Stefan Frei showed up with some new ink -- a Cup championship star on the very hand that made The Save.

Then, well, Frei and the team showed up -- but so did thousands and thousands of fans. You've got to see photos to appreciate the scale of the crowd.


So it's no wonder that Herculez Gomez found it a convenient venue to crowd-surf.

Roman Torres, meanwhile, tried to get Jordan Morris to join him in one of his trademark breakout dance parties.

And one of the most memorable moments? Brian Schmetzer continued his legacy of being one of the most humble, friendly MLS coaches ever. At one point, he stepped down off his parade trolley, and asked Emerald City Supporters if he could, instead, march with them. Of course they were stoked to welcome him along.

And of course, he capped it all off by freely doling out hugs.
